Abstract
Experimental investigations aiming at the reduction of the aerodynamic drag of a 2D bluff body by closed-loop flow control are conducted. Pulsed suction at the rear end of the body has been applied. The controllers exploit measurements of the base pressure of the body since the base pressure correlates well with the drag. Disturbances in terms of changed oncoming flow conditions have been examined. Furthermore, a second 2D bluff body appearing in the wake of the first body disturbs the flow field. A model predictive and a robust model predictive controller have been tested successfully in experiments and are compared.
